This high-resolution 4K seamless PBR texture showcases a close-up view of a cracked denim fabric surface. The main visual elements include tightly woven blue cotton threads interlaced with white fibers, creating the characteristic denim weave. The texture highlights areas of wear and cracking where individual threads appear frayed, revealing subtle splits and cracks throughout the weave. The pattern is mostly horizontal, corresponding to the weaving direction, with irregular, randomly scattered tiny holes and thread separation indicating heavy usage or aging fabric. The surface feel is rough, worn, and slightly coarse, representing well-distressed denim material. The color palette ranges from deep indigo blue to faded lighter blue and white accents, enhancing the natural variance of real denim. This tileable texture is fully PBR-ready, utilizing proper maps to represent fabric roughness and subtle thread height variations. Using This PBR Texture in Blender

Import the texture maps into Blender with sRGB color space for albedo/base color and Non-Color for normal, roughness, metallic, AO, height, and ORM maps. Connect normal maps through a Normal Map node, then adjust UV scale with a Mapping node so the material repeats naturally on your model.

  • Albedo -> Principled BSDF Base Color
  • Roughness -> Roughness, Metallic -> Metallic
  • Normal -> Normal Map node -> Normal
  • Height -> Bump or Displacement depending on render setup
